part of speech: |
noun |
definition: |
in grammar, a word, phrase, or clause that functions as a noun and is placed, without a conjunction, immediately after a noun or noun equivalent that refers to the same person, place, or thing, such as "a devoted scholar" in "my mother, a devoted scholar".

part of speech: |
adjective |
definition: |
in grammar, placed in apposition; functioning as an appositive.
